OverviewIn this second poetry collection, Virginia Betts is once more preoccupied with the relentless ticking of time and the fragility of life, but That Little Voice is also a mixture of introspection and observation. Betts manipulates language using vivid imagery to tantalise the senses and immerse the reader. Satirical, at times melancholy, and often autobiographical, she may have The Last Word, but you know there will always be more.
